In this article, a numerical implementation of the exact kinetic energy operator (KEO) for triatomic molecules (symmetric of XY2-type and asymmetric of YXZ-type) is presented. The implementation is based on the valence coordinates with the bisecting (XY2-type molecules) and bond-vector (YXZ) embeddings and includes the treatment of the singularity at linear geometry. The KEO is represented in a sum-of-product form. The singularity caused by the undetermined angle at the linear configuration is resolved with the help of the associated Legendre and Laguerre polynomials used as parameterized bending basis functions in the finite basis set representation. The exact KEO implementation is combined with the variational solver theoretical rovibrational energies, equipped with a general automatic symmetry-adaptation procedure and efficient basis step contraction schemes, providing a powerful computational solver of triatomic molecules for accurate computations of highly excited ro-vibrational spectra. The advantages of different basis set choices are discussed. Examples of specific applications for computing hot spectra of linear molecules are given.

Introduction: There is a need for educational resources supporting the practice and assessment of the complex processes of clinical reasoning in the inpatient setting along a continuum of physician experience levels. Methods: Using participatory design, we created a scenario-based simulation integrating diagnostic ambiguity, contextual factors, and rising patient acuity to increase complexity. Resources include an open-ended written exercise and think-aloud reflection protocol to elicit diagnostic and management reasoning and reflection on that reasoning. Descriptive statistics were used to analyze the initial implementation evaluation results. Results: Twenty physicians from multiple training stages and specialties (interns, residents, attendings, family physicians, internists, surgeons) underwent the simulated scenario. Participants engaged in clinical reasoning processes consistent with the design, considering a total of 19 differential diagnoses. Ten participants provided the correct leading diagnosis, tension pneumothorax, with an additional eight providing pneumothorax and all participants offering relevant supporting evidence. There was also good evidence of management reasoning, with all participants either performing an intervention or calling for assistance and reflecting on management plans in the think-aloud. The scenario was a reasonable approximation of clinical practice, with a mean authenticity rating of 4.15 out of 5. Finally, the scenario presented adequate challenge, with interns and residents rating it as only slightly more challenging (means of 7.83 and 7.17, respectively) than attendings (mean of 6.63 out of 10). Discussion: Despite the challenges of scenario complexity, evaluation results indicate that this resource supports the observation and analysis of diagnostic and management reasoning of diverse specialties from interns through attendings.

INTRODUCTION: In 2018, the American College of Physicians formally acknowledged the importance of Point of Care Ultrasound (POCUS) to the practice of internal medicine (IM). For the military internist, POCUS training is critical for care of the trauma patient in austere environments, mass casualty events and natural disasters. While emergency medicine and critical care training programs have adopted POCUS education, few IM programs have integrated POCUS into their core curricula. We designed and implemented an iterative POCUS curriculum for trainees at a large military IM residency program over a two-year period. METHODS: In collaboration with our critical care and simulation departments, we developed a pilot curriculum consisting of five, 60-minute courses offered on a voluntary basis at monthly intervals throughout 2017. Based on the pilot's success we incorporated a POCUS curriculum into the core academics received by all IM trainees during the 2017-2018 academic year. Trainees attended seven, 3-hour sessions during their scheduled academic time taught by subspecialists with POCUS expertise in an on-site simulation center. Baseline surveys and knowledge assessment examinations were administered during orientation and repeated at the end of the academic year. Comparison of results before and after the POCUS curriculum was the primary outcome evaluated. RESULTS: Intervention #1: Pilot, 2016-2017 Academic Year45 trainees attended at least one course with an average of 1.8 sessions per trainee. Baseline survey data showed 91% of trainees believe POCUS is quite or extremely beneficial for their patients, but 73% feel slightly or not at all confident in POCUS knowledge. The pre-test mean and median scores were 71% and 77% respectively, which both increased to a post-test mean and median of 81%. Post-test mean percentage correct for trainees attending 1, 2, or 3 courses was 74%, 82%, and 91% respectively. Intervention #2: Incorporation of POCUS into Core Academics, 2017-2018 Academic YearAll 75 trainees participated in training with an average of 3.77 sessions attended per trainee. Survey analysis revealed significant improvement in confidence of performing ultrasound-guided procedures (p = 0.0139), and a 37% absolute increase in respondents who anticipate using ultrasound in their clinical practice (p = 0.0003). The mean pre-test score was 67.8% with median of 63.6% while mean and median post-test scores were 82.1% and 81.8%, with an absolute improvement of 14.3% and 18.2% respectively (p = 0.0004). CONCLUSION: A structured POCUS curriculum was successfully incorporated at a large multiservice military IM residency program, with demonstrated retention of knowledge, improved confidence in performance of ultrasound guided invasive procedures, and increased interest in the use of POCUS in future clinical practice. Similar programs should be implemented across all IM programs in military graduate medical education to enhance operational readiness and battlefield care.

Infectious suppurative thrombophlebitis of the portal venous system, referred to as pylephlebitis, is a rare complication of intra-abdominal inflammatory processes. Advances in diagnostics and antibiotics have improved survival, but mortality remains remarkably high even in the most recent literature. The majority of patients have concomitant bacteraemia on presentation most commonly with typical gastrointestinal (GI) organisms. On rare occasion, patients have culture positive Fusobacterium, which has recently been associated with occult GI and genitourinary malignancies. Here, we describe a patient presenting with pylephlebitis and Fusobacterium bacteraemia who responded well to medical therapy, review pertinent literature and discuss the benefits of screening endoscopy in this patient population.
